WebQ: Is it ok to leave boiled or baked potatoes out overnight for potato salad? A: NO! This is the wrong way to do it and is not food safe. Cooked starch foods like potatoes can grow … You cannot leave your baked potato out overnight on the countertop in room temperature and then eat it – after four hours this baked potato will be swarming with bacteria. On the other hand, leaving your baked potato in the refrigerator overnight before consuming is perfectly acceptable.
